About Robert

Robert W. Hladun, K.C., founded Hladun & Company in 1978 and holds a Juris Doctor and a Bachelor of Arts in Economics from the University of Alberta. He was called to the bar in Alberta in 1974 and in Saskatchewan in 1982. He was federally appointed Queen's Counsel in 1992 and served as Honorary Consul of the Dominican Republic in Alberta beginning in 1989. He has appeared before courts in Alberta, Saskatchewan, British Columbia, Ontario, Nova Scotia, the Northwest Territories, and the Yukon, as well as the Federal Court, the Federal Court of Appeal, and the Supreme Court of Canada, and has provided legal consultation in numerous countries internationally.
